Did You Know That Tim McGraw Is a Fraternity Member?
It's true: Tim McGraw is a member of the Pi Kappa Alpha fraternity.
McGraw pledged the Eta Omicron Chapter of Pi Kappa Alpha at Northeast Louisiana University (now the University of Louisiana at Monroe), where he attended on a baseball scholarship. He officially became a "Pike" on January 18, 1986. According to the frat's website, McGraw is still involved with the chapter as an alum.
